I live in Detroit and I see this stuff everyday. In fact, I'm part of it, helping with design and the like when I can. Whether it's hipsters, hippies, yuppies or any other similar group doesn't really matter. Actually the community working on the reconstruction of Detroit is really diverse and the trailer does a poor job of representing that. The point is that there is a culture of people willing to stay and work on this rather than chase opportunity elsewhere. Is it going to take more than art, design, coffee shops, neighborhood farms and BBQ joints to do it? Of course, we are under no delusion that it will be easy and many days we feel like Sisyphus but we labor on in our passions and try our best to make this city a better more livable place. I don't think tracing should detract from the end product. It's a technique not unlike cross hatching. Then again I also believe that the aesthetic rearrangement is on par with creation. For example “Girl Talk” is not a traditional musician but his artful rearrangement of pop songs could be considered original music. Moreover, I think the idea of tracing something meant to be so realistic makes sense as part of the process. We could easily dismiss a myriad of art and artist if we bind ourselves to traditional technique. A large part of the Warhol catalog wouldn't exist if that were the case. “mechanical reproduction emancipates the work of art from its parasitical dependence on ritual.” - Walter Benjamin
